Ports

Salvador da Bahia in Brazil used to be the colonial capital, and is one of the oldest cities in the Americas. Today it is a lively place with 3.5 million inhabitants, noted for its cuisine, music, and architecture. Around Salvador you can go swimming, sailing, diving, surfing, and underwater fishing in the bays and inlets. But don’t forget to visit both the High City and the Low City, as they offer shopping, parks, and entertainment for locals and seafaring visitors alike.

Punta del Este is a city in southeastern Uruguay, popular among the tourists for its many attractions. Climb the beautiful, 45-metre high lighthouse for amazing views, see La Mano de Punta del Este, famous sculpture which is a symbol of town and enjoy watersports on the scenic beaches. If you're lucky, you may even spot a southern right whale!

You sail on the Anne-Margaretha

Shipping type: Ketch
Homeport: Haarlem (NL)
Date built: 1998
Trainees: 10
Length: 22m
Height of mast: 22
Sail: 515 m2
